Performance advantages
High bandwidth: The Ka band has a wide available bandwidth of up to several GHz, which can support high-speed data transmission. For example, in satellite communication scenarios, data transmission rates of up to several Gbps can be achieved, meeting application scenarios with extremely high bandwidth requirements such as high-definition video live broadcast and fast transmission of big data.
Miniaturization and integration: With the continuous advancement of semiconductor processes and circuit design technologies, Ka-band transceivers have been highly integrated. Many functional circuits are integrated in a compact module, which greatly reduces the size and weight of the device. In some portable satellite communication terminals, the miniaturized design of the Ka-band transceiver makes the device easy to carry, providing convenience for field operations, emergency communications and other scenarios.
Low interference: Compared with some low-frequency bands, the use of the Ka band is relatively less crowded, less subject to interference, and the stability and reliability of signal transmission are higher. This allows the Ka-band transceiver to still ensure communication quality and smooth communication in complex electromagnetic environments, such as urban central areas.
Application fields
Satellite communication: Ka-band transceivers are the core components of satellite communication systems and are widely used in communication links between ground stations and satellites. In high-throughput satellite communication systems, Ka-band transceivers enable high-speed, high-capacity data transmission, support services such as Internet access and multimedia transmission, provide broadband network services for remote areas, and help narrow the digital divide.
